A highlight of the tennis calendar is Wimbledon and Tenby Tennis Club was delighted again to be able to take a group up to watch some fantastic tennis at this famous venue.
The children aged between eight and 16 were excited despite the very early start and the anticipation in the minibus grew with every passing mile.
We arrived in time to take our seats in Court 1 and watch Andy Murray play great tennis to go through to the next round. We also saw Petra Kvitova and Jo-Wilfried Tsonga both win their matches in great style. We were also lucky enough to have two tickets for centre court and took turns to watch Sabine Lisicki followed by the wonderful Roger Federer. We were then treated to the incredible display by Dustin Brown to beat Rafael Nedal. It was a truly wonderful day and every one of our party were thrilled to have been able to watch such terrific tennis in such a magnificent setting.
All the children behaved extremely well and were a credit to Tenby Tennis Club on this exhausting and exciting day out and we returned to Tenby in the early hours with a few souvenirs, some fantastic memories and hopefully a few tips too!
